So market basket's entire thing is "more for your dollar." Item prices are set to the same at all of their stores so you know what you're getting from place to place. Their very good about being well stocked and having a mix of high quality and good value foods.

The main reason I can think of why they're in Shrewsbury and not Worcester is taxes and shrewsbury being a central location for Boroughs, Grafton, and Worcester. (So 200k in worcester but there's also about 200k in all of those other towns combined)

Many people in worcester are already driving 20 minutes North to Leominster or south to Oxford. So driving 10 minutes west is easy enough.

Edit: there are about 100k in those towns combined not 200k
